MP Ndindi Nyoro assigned to Diaspora Affairs Committee

Kiharu Member of Parliament Ndindi Nyoro has been reassigned from the Budget and Appropriations Committee to the Diaspora Affairs and Migrant Workers Committee following a wide-ranging reshuffle of National Assembly committees. The changes were adopted by the House on Tuesday, July 29, after a motion tabled by Majority Whip Silvanus Osoro received parliamentary approval.

Under the new lineup, Edwin Mugo Gichuki replaces Ndindi Nyoro’s on the Budget Committee. Gichuki’s previous role in the Departmental Committee on Tourism and Wildlife now goes to Leah Sopiato Sankaire.

Shakeel Shabbir, MP for Kisumu East, has joined the Committee on Powers and Privileges alongside Jane Njeri Maina. They replace John Bwire and James Oyoo, who have been redeployed to other committees. Oyoo now sits on the Decentralized Funds Accounts Committee, replacing Joyce Bensuda Osogo.

The reshuffle also filled slots left vacant by the deaths of two sitting lawmakers. Bensuda Joyce Atieno Osogo has replaced the late Charles Ong’ondo Were in the Blue Economy, Water, and Irrigation Committee. Peter Ochieng’ Orero now joins the National Cohesion and Equal Opportunity Committee, also filling a slot left by the late Charles Were.

In a reciprocal swap, Muiruri Muthama Stanley and Chepkwony Charity Kathambi exchanged roles between the Blue Economy and Implementation Committees.

Other significant changes include:

  • Mary Wamaua Njoroge replacing Liza Chelule Chepkorir in the Labor Committee.
  • Chelule now serves in the Regional Development Committee, replacing Mary Emaase Otucho, who moves to the Public Accounts Committee.
  • John Bwire moves to the Trade, Industry, and Cooperatives Committee, filling the gap left by Geoffrey Ruku, who was appointed Cabinet Secretary for Public Service.
  • Nimrod Mbai joins the Constitutional Implementation Oversight Committee, replacing Eric Muchangi Karemba.
  • Karemba now sits on the Public Petitions Committee along with Patrick Munene Ntwiga, replacing Ernest Kagesi and Mbai, respectively.

The National Assembly shared the full list of committee changes on its official social media account following the vote.

“The House has approved changes to its committee memberships,” the Assembly outlined. “These adjustments ensure continued functionality and equitable representation in line with ongoing legislative demands.”

The realignment reflects the shifting responsibilities within Parliament and follows recent appointments to the Cabinet, deaths of serving members, and committee performance reviews.
